Taming The Roof: How Polyjoy Solves Industrial Leakage And Energy Drain at Scale

 Project Background & Challenge
In 2023, a 40,000m² food processing plant in Shandong Province faced three critical issues with its existing metal roof:
Severe leakage: The old standing seam metal roof panels had failed at seam joints, causing water damage to production lines and raw materials.
High energy costs: The single-skin metal roof had no insulation, leading to extreme temperature fluctuations and HVAC bills exceeding $120,000 annually.
Fire safety risk: The previous roof system used EPS core panels (B2 fire rating), which did not meet updated local fire codes requiring A1 non-combustible materials for food processing facilities.
The client needed a complete roof replacement solution that would solve all three problems simultaneously.

2. Solution Selection
After evaluating multiple options, the project team selected Polyjoy metal roof sandwich panels from Hongxing Technology (Glostar brand). The chosen product was the TW PU Edge-Sealed Rock Wool Sandwich Panel with the following specifications:

Parameter

Value

Panel thickness

100mm

Core material

Rock wool (density 120 kg/m³)

Fire rating

A1 non-combustible (GB 8624)

Thermal conductivity

0.032 W/m·K

Steel gauge

0.6mm outer / 0.5mm inner

Coating

PVDF (20-year warranty)

Edge sealing

PU polyurethane edge seal

Panel width

1000mm

Panel length

Custom up to 15m



Why this product?
PU edge sealing provided 40% better waterproofing at joints compared to standard rock wool panels .
Rock wool core ensured A1 fire rating with 120-minute fire resistance at 100mm thickness .
PVDF coating offered 20-year durability in the coastal Shandong environment .
Steel roof sandwich panels with hidden fastener design eliminated through-penetration leakage points.
3. Installation Process
The installation was completed in 25 days by a team of 12 workers, using the following method:
Substructure preparation: Existing purlins were inspected and reinforced where needed.
Panel placement: Panels were lifted by crane and positioned using tongue-and-groove interlocking.
Fastening: Hidden clips secured panels without penetrating the surface, maintaining waterproof integrity.
Edge sealing: All end joints were sealed with PU foam and silicone sealant.
Flashing & trim: Custom flashings were installed at ridge, eave, and valley locations.
The insulated metal roof panels were installed in a standing seam configuration, allowing for thermal expansion without compromising seal integrity.

4. Measurable Results
After 3 years of operation, the project delivered the following outcomes:

Metric

Before

After

Improvement

Roof leakage incidents

12 per year (average)

0

100% elimination

Annual HVAC energy cost

$125,000

$75,000

40% reduction

Interior temperature fluctuation

±8°C

±2°C

75% improvement

Fire rating compliance

B2 (non-compliant)

A1 (fully compliant)

Passed inspection

Maintenance cost per year

$15,000

$2,000

87% reduction

5. Why This Solution Works for Industrial Roofs
5.1 Superior Waterproofing
The PU roof sandwich panels feature a polyurethane edge seal that creates a continuous barrier at panel joints. This is critical for low-slope industrial roofs where water pooling is common. The hidden fastener system eliminates the #1 cause of metal roof leaks: fastener penetration.
5.2 Energy Efficiency
With a thermal conductivity of just 0.032 W/m·K, the rock wool roof panels provide excellent insulation. In summer, the roof reflects solar heat (PVDF coating has 70% solar reflectance), while in winter, the rock wool core retains interior heat. This dual action reduced HVAC load by 40%.
5.3 Fire Safety
The A1 fire rating of the rock wool core means the panels will not burn, melt, or produce toxic smoke in a fire. This is mandatory for food processing, pharmaceutical, and chemical facilities. The steel roof sandwich panels also provide 120-minute fire resistance, giving occupants time to evacuate.
5.4 Long-Term Durability
The PVDF coating on the metal roof sandwich panels is tested to withstand 20 years of UV exposure without chalking or fading. The rock wool core is hydrophobic (≥98% water repellency), so even if the outer skin is damaged, the insulation will not absorb moisture and lose performance .

6. Comparison with Alternative Roof Systems

Feature

Polyjoy Metal Roof Sandwich Panels

Traditional Standing Seam Metal Roof

Built-up Roof (BUR)

Insulation

Built-in (rock wool)

Requires separate insulation layer

Requires separate insulation

Fire rating

A1 (non-combustible)

B1 (steel only)

Varies (often B2)

Installation speed

600-800 m²/day

200-300 m²/day

150-200 m²/day

Lifespan

20+ years

15-20 years

10-15 years

Maintenance

Low (no exposed fasteners)

Medium (seam maintenance)

High (membrane repairs)

Cost per m² (installed)

$28-35

$25-30 (plus insulation cost)

$20-25 (plus insulation)



7. Key Takeaways for Specifiers
For roof leakage problems: Choose metal roof sandwich panels with PU edge sealing and hidden fasteners. This eliminates the most common failure points.
For energy savings: Select insulated metal roof panels with rock wool or PIR core. A 100mm thick panel can reduce HVAC costs by 40% or more.
For fire safety: Mandate A1 fire rated rock wool roof panels. This is non-negotiable for food, pharmaceutical, and public buildings.
For coastal or corrosive environments: Specify PVDF coating on steel roof sandwich panels for 20-year durability.
For fast installation: Choose PU roof sandwich panels with tongue-and-groove interlocking. A 40,000m² roof can be completed in 25 days with a small crew.
